I am currently running a 10 GPU mining rig with only 4GB RAM on Windows 10. Just want to share my experience:
-Boot up takes around 3-5 minutes. -After around 8 hours of mining if you check back the entire screen and all programs (claymore, afterburner, teamviewer, etc) is laggy/choppy
It seems that memory is all used up after some time and you have to restart the computer if you want to reconfigure things. Otherwise, it mines the same. All good and perfectly well. Mining is not affected. If you want fast ROI and dont mind the lag, id say 4gb RAM is enough.

Although we will never hit exactly 21 million the block subsidy is set to deplete at block 6,930,000 which is estimated to occur sometime around the year 2140.
However, the vast majority of bitcoin (99%) will have been mined by around 2032, when the block subsidy drops to less than 1 BTC per block. Roughly 20.67 million coins will exist, leaving less than 1/2 a million to be mined over the next 100 years.

It is always better to use a single PSU for power efficiency and retail price savings. Just get one with high enough wattage to support your GPU power draw.
To answer your question directly, yes different power supplies will work together regardless of brand or wattage. What you need to make them both work is ADD2PSU: a product that allows you to activate both power supplies with the system. Or you could use the "paperclip technique" to activate both PSUs. If you have the Samsung memory, like the OP does, make sure you use the August-23 AMD Blockchain drivers. If you are using that and you have OC-ed the memstraps of your card to use 1500 (also don't forget to decrease voltage) the only thing left to do will be to overclock your memory. For my rx 470s i've found that its safe to OC memory up to and between 1950 and 2000. With this, I get at least 26 MH hash rate.
